The beginning of the school year brings busy schedules, routine adjustments, and—for many—lots of stress. Parents and caregivers juggle concerns about academics, mental health, social media, school safety, sleep, and busy family schedules. Being prepared, mindful, and having the necessary tools to organize your family routines can help reduce your stress and anxiety.

Child and adolescent psychologist Dr. Allison Stiles, PhD, and clinical psychologist Dr. Melissa Heatly provide tips for children and teens adjusting to a new routine.

Melissa Heatly, PhD, Receives Satcher Early-Stage Faculty Award

Friday, May 8, 2026

Melissa Heatly and group receiving awardsBuilding Healthier Communities: Satcher Awards Honor Those Making a Difference

Melissa Heatly, PhD, a clinical child and adolescent psychologist and assistant professor of Psychiatry, was honored with the Satcher Early-Stage Faculty award.  Through her work with the Rochester City School District (RCSD), she has dramatically improved access to mental healthcare for children and youth who are among our most vulnerable because of poverty and social drivers of health.
